public interface CreateReleasesCmd extends TaskCommand
ALLC
").Input is
Output is
com.ibm.commerce.inventory.objects.OrderReleaseAccessBeans
for the created releasesReleases are created with a "NEW" status. At release to fulfillment time, all "NEW" releases should be released to fulfillment
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
COPYRIGHT
IBM Copyright notice field.
|
static java.lang.String |
defaultCommandClassName
The name of the default implementation class for this command interface.
|
static java.lang.String |
NAME
The name of this command interface.
|
Modifier and Type | Method and Description |
---|---|
java.lang.Integer |
getFirstReleaseNumber()
This method gets the first release number created.
|
java.lang.Integer |
getLastReleaseNumber()
This method gets the last release number created.
|
java.util.List |
getReleases()
This method gets the generated order releases.
|
void |
setOrder(OrderAccessBean abOrder)
This methods sets the order that releases will be created for.
|
void |
setOrderItems(OrderItemAccessBean[] abOrderItems)
This methods sets the order items that releases will be created for.
|
executeFromCache, getCaller, getEntryInfo, getId, getSharingPolicy, postExecute, preExecute, setCaller, updateCache
getCommandTarget, getCommandTargetName, hasOutputProperties, performExecute, setCommandTarget, setCommandTargetName, setOutputProperties
checkIsAllowed, checkResourcePermission, createCommandExecutionEvent, getAccCheck, getCommandContext, getCommandIfName, getCommandName, getCommandStoreId, getDefaultProperties, getExceptionInvokeParameters, getPostInvokeParameters, getPreInvokeParameters, getResources, getStoreId, getUser, getUserId, performExecute, setAccCheck, setCommandContext, setCommandIfName, setCommandStoreId, setDefaultProperties, validateParameters
static final java.lang.String COPYRIGHT
static final java.lang.String NAME
static final java.lang.String defaultCommandClassName
void setOrder(OrderAccessBean abOrder)
abOrder
- the OrderAccessBean representing the order that the releases will be created for.void setOrderItems(OrderItemAccessBean[] abOrderItems)
abOrderItems
- an array of OrderItemAccessBean representing the order items for the
order that should be used as candidates for inclusion in releases.java.lang.Integer getLastReleaseNumber()
java.lang.Integer getFirstReleaseNumber()
java.util.List getReleases()
com.ibm.commerce.inventory.objects.OrderReleaseAccessBean